HUMPHREY v. COLEMAN

83-1-222; CA A36839.

739 P.2d 1081 (1987)

86 Or.App. 511

James L. HUMPHREY, Appellant, v. Robert M. COLEMAN, Respondent.

Court of Appeals of Oregon.

Decided July 22, 1987.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

D. Ronald Gerber, Florence, argued the cause and filed the brief for appellant.

Frederic D. Canning, Oregon City, argued the cause for respondent. With him on the brief was Canning, Tait & McKenzie, P.C., Oregon City.

Before RICHARDSON, P.J., and NEWMAN and DEITS, JJ.


DEITS, Judge.

In this personal injury negligence action, plaintiff appeals from a judgment on a directed verdict.1 We reverse and remand.

Defendant was driving north on Highway 213 in Clackamas County at about 11 p.m. while intoxicated. Trooper Hupp saw him traveling at about 65-75 miles per hour in a 25 mile per hour zone, weaving from lane to lane.
